Output 58d9846bab264f5a6ac7003c6bbebc7167ae801b7e10b6d63ec7e05b44ec0838:0

value
382054
script pubkey
OP_0 OP_PUSHBYTES_20 de52c5620a7ec6f1786bd1713c6a407449bbb4b1
address
bc1qmefv2cs20mr0z7rt69cnc6jqw3ymhd93qya863
transaction
58d9846bab264f5a6ac7003c6bbebc7167ae801b7e10b6d63ec7e05b44ec0838
spent
true